Global Nanocomposites Market to Reach 989 Million Pounds by 2010, According to New Report by Global Industry Analysts, Inc.
Nanocomposites
play a significant role in one of the most promising technologies known
as nanotechnology. Worldwide demand for nanocomposites is increasing
rapidly in packaging, automotive, electrical, and other applications
due to their superior thermal, electrical conductive and other
properties. Development of industry related nanocomposites with
enhanced features and expanding research activities in development of
new nanocomposites are some of the factors that would drive
nanocomposites market in the coming years.

Global nanocomposites market
is projected to reach 989 million pounds by the end of the decade, as
stated in a report published by Global Industry Analysts, Inc. United
States and Europe dominate the global nanocomposites market, with a
collective share of over 80% of the volume sales for 2008. The markets
are also projected to witness rapid growth, driven by enhanced volume
consumption of nanocomposites in various applications. Research
institutions and companies are engaged in the exploration of efficient
methods for developing nanocomposites in large volumes, and at lower
cost.
Applications of nanocomposite plastics are diversified, with automotive
and packaging accounting for a majority of the consumption. Increased
R&D activities and advent of innovative materials is expected to
widen the application areas for nanocomposites. Packaging segment
represents the largest end-use market for nanocomposites in the world,
with consumption estimated at 284 million pounds for 2008. Automotive
segment is projected to generate the fastest demand for nancomposites
during the period 2001-2010. Rise in demand and easy accessibility of
nanocomposites would lead to their extensive usage in a wide range of
applications.
Nanocomposite research is widespread and is conducted by companies
and universities across the globe. Several global plastic suppliers
have already commercialized products based on nanocomposite materials,
with majority of the efforts focused on either nylons or polyolefins.
Other industries are also optimistic about the future role of these
novel materials, attributed to the growing volume of research studies
being conducted across the world. The development of innovative
nanocomposite polyolefins, and an array of other resin matrixes and
nanofillers is also expected to bolster the market scenario.
Technological advancements would reduce manufacturing costs, enabling
the development of low-cost nanocomposites.
